Had a call from the dealer out of the blue last week and its being delivered to me this coming Friday. I would have waited until September but I need it for a family holiday the coming weekend.

The technology plus package is affected by the semiconductor shortage with several options such as wireless charging not being available. A few weeks ago you could add the pack but the price changed to £4495; they must just be figuring out which components they can source going forward.

Quote:
Originally Posted by scsfll View Post
My M550 has been sitting at port in New Jersey for 2+ weeks. How do I find out what the issue is?
My dealer is telling me that the 8 cylider gets delayed longer by Feds?
You don't. Your dealer is making up excuses.

In July/August of some new MY sometimes cars get stuck on a monroney hold while BMW provides necessary documentation to the EPA. I doubt that's the case here. More than likely the port is awaiting a part or other campaign hold on your car. Or, maybe the port is just extremely busy. You can ask dealer to show you the status in DCSnet to double check car was not transport damaged and being repaired at the port.
